Downtown Street Scenes: Granville, Robson, Burrard, and W. Georgia Streets

Item is a set of negatives of street photography scenes in downtown Vancouver. The scenes were captured roughly along a route beginning at Granville Street and W. Georgia Street, proceeding southwest on Granville Street, northwest onto Robson Street, northeast onto Burrard Street, and finally southeast onto W. Georgia Street to the intersection of W. Georgia Street and Seymour Street. The photograph subjects are everyday street scenes, predominantly storefronts of local businesses, department stores, pedestrians on the sidewalk, and buses. This set contains the raw photographs from the roll the photographer shot in their original order. The associated contact sheet has selection marks for frames 7, 21, and 31.

Seens [scenes] of Van[couver], Capilano, Stanley Park

Item is a film showing various scenes around Vancouver. The first half of this film documents a Gray Line Tours bus trip through Vancouver and second half contains scenes showing landmarks of Vancouver and surrounding areas. Film contains footage showing: Empress of Japan Figurehead in Stanley Park, U.B.C., Chinatown, Hotel Georgia, Lion's Gate Bridge, Court House, Capilano Suspension Bridge, Capilano Golf and Country Club, Prospect Point, Stanley Park, views of downtown and North Shore Mountains from Little Mountain, City Hall, sailboats in Burrard Inlet, and Swimmers at Kits Beach.

Sheraton Landmark hotel under construction

Item is a photograph of the Sheraton Landmark hotel under construction, from Robson Street, looking northwest. Some storefront and signage of local businesses are visible along Robson Street in the foreground. Nelmar Cafe (1190 Robson Street), Robson Foods Market (1204 Robson Street), Dun-Rite Cleaners (1208 Robson Street), and Daily Food Store (1212 Robson Street) are along the street to the left. On the right is the entrance for the Blue Horizon hotel (1225 Robson Street).

Water Street from the intersection of Carroll Street and Alexander Street

Item part is a photograph from Maple Tree Square with a view west down Water Street from the intersection of Carroll Street and Alexander Street Some pedestrians walk through the square while others are congregating around a Greyhound bus. The identified establishments in the photograph are The Quest (Quest Team Three design projects Ltd., 1 Alexander Street), The International Gold Scale (121 Carrall Street), Lickety Split, and the partial signage of the Old Spaghetti Factory is visible further along Water Street The statue of Gassy Jack is visible at the far right.
